I'm partially done now... I dynamatted the hatch to hell and the floor and enclosures are done. Next steps are vinyl installation, electrical wiring, tuning. What do you think so far?

4 sq. ft. of Dynamat Extreme costed $30 -


3 sheets of this from McMaster for $40! -


I lined the entire hatch area -


Taped off the air vent -


Stuffed the spare tire well with pillows. (not picture: I also used fiberglass insulation with sound dampening properies in the tire well and behind panels.)


Enclosure/false floor in its infancy -


left view (Stinger cap & RF distribution) -


right view (MB Quart crossovers & Sony Unilink TV Tuner/Video Input)
